Suddenly then the table would become a little easier on the eye. The other game in hand we have is a home fixture against Yeovil Town, which will be played in March.

Of course if we lost tonight another team in the relegation zone becomes 3 points closer to us. Then the thought of relegation really will be on Walsall fans minds.

Tonights match could have a huge bearing on our season. Walsall have been playing much better of late but we are not turning these performances into wins. 

Paul Merson is still talking up our play off hopes. Beat Swindon and there still is a extreamly outside chance. Lose toinight and his thoughts sound comical.

A win at the County Ground will put us on 38 points. To achieve a play off place this season Walsall can only realistically lose 4 more games. Any more than this and we will have another season of League One football or worse to look forward too!
